Maintaining Biodiversity

 

The richness of a natural environment depends in large part on its biological diversity. That is why Kruger’s team of experts chooses forest management methods and strategies that protect the many forest resources.

Forest access road construction, timber harvesting and silviculture are all guided by stringent environmental protection standards.

We are particularly careful to protect the quality of water and wooded strips are left intact along riverbanks and around lakes to maintain wildlife habitats and to preserve the aesthetic value of the forest. Special attention is also paid to the protection of sensitive areas, such as waterfowl habitats and peatlands, and to the maintenance of a variety of tree species.

At Kruger, maintaining biodiversity is an ever increasing and constant concern. Given the scope of the challenge, and in order to ensure a solid foundation for our forest management activities, more and more measures are taken to improve our knowledge of forest ecology.
